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| bull-oak | Niger Delta Red Colobus |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(植物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(被子植物門) | Chordata (脊索動物)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(モクレン綱) | Mammalia (哺乳類) |
| Order | Fagales (ブナ目) | Primates (サル目) |
| Family | Casuarinaceae |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) |
| Genus | Allocasuarina | Piliocolobus |
| Species | Allocasuarina fraseriana | Piliocolobus epieni |
